Weeknight Banh Mi Sandwich
Fast bánh mì sandwiches filled with savoury pork meatballs, carrot-daikon pickles, cucumber, jalapeño, coriander and nuoc cham.

Ingredients
- [Pickled carrot and daikon] 150g daikon, shredded
- [Pickled carrot and daikon] 150g carrot, shredded
- [Pickled carrot and daikon] 200g water
- [Pickled carrot and daikon] 100g rice vinegar
- [Pickled carrot and daikon] 100g white vinegar
- [Pickled carrot and daikon] 40g sugar
- [Pickled carrot and daikon] 4g salt
- [Pork meatballs] 900g ground pork
- [Pork meatballs] 10g salt
- [Pork meatballs] 25g sugar
- [Pork meatballs] 5g black pepper
- [Pork meatballs] 10g cornflour
- [Pork meatballs] 60g fish sauce
- [Pork meatballs] 30g garlic, grated or minced
- [Pork meatballs] 30g fresh ginger, grated
- [Pork meatballs] 60g shallot, finely minced
- [Pork meatballs] 20g basil, minced
- [Nuoc cham] 120g water
- [Nuoc cham] 45g fish sauce
- [Nuoc cham] 25g sugar
- [Nuoc cham] Juice of 1 lime, about 25g
- [Nuoc cham] 10g garlic, minced
- [Nuoc cham] 10g sambal
- [Assembly] 1 English cucumber, cut into thin planks
- [Assembly] 1 jalapeño, thinly sliced
- [Assembly] Fresh coriander, roughly chopped
- [Assembly] 4 baguettes or hoagie rolls
- [Assembly] Mayonnaise
Method
- [Pickles] Bring the water, both vinegars, sugar and salt to a boil. Add the shredded daikon and carrot, submerge them, remove from the heat and cool.
- [Meatballs] Heat the oven to 245°C/475°F. Mix all meatball ingredients thoroughly.
- [Meatballs] Form roughly 55g/2oz balls and arrange at least 2.5cm apart on a parchment-lined tray.
- [Meatballs] Bake for 12–15 minutes, until the centres reach at least 74°C/165°F.
- [Nuoc cham] Stir all sauce ingredients together until the sugar dissolves.
- [Assembly] Warm the baguettes in the hot oven for about 2 minutes, until crisp outside.
- [Assembly] Split each baguette without cutting through the hinge. Spread mayonnaise inside.
- [Assembly] Add halved meatballs, drained carrot-daikon pickle, cucumber, jalapeño and coriander. Finish with nuoc cham.
